The role:

The ideal candidate will be required to interview industry figureheads, build up their contacts to break news stories online ahead of competitors as well as be competent to write longer feature articles for the monthly print publication.

In an increasingly digital word, candidates should know enough about SEO and what makes a good story stand out online to get to the top of the Google charts. There will also be an opportunity to improve your video filming and editing skills as the publication becomes ever-more digital.

The traditional magazine is the leading title in the sector, despite plenty of competition. Candidates should feel comfortable proofing and editing copy from non-English speakers as well as confident enough to write their own articles. Some of the big topics of today, such as climate change and the environment, digitalisation of the workplace and the impact of increased urbanisation, are all covered in the title.

The role also involves the organisation of frequent conferences and webinars. Candidates will be expected to source good speakers for these events. The job will also include involvement in our own face to face exhibitions and conferences when travel returns.

Key responsibilities:

Write, sub and proof editorial copy such as news and features, to break news stories ahead of the opposition, to ensure the quality of production, to maintain house-style, factual accuracy and objectivity and to meet deadlines
Progress editorial material to schedule to ensure that journals are planned for best use of space
Support the Editor to ensure that deadlines are met
Produce video copy for online and social media
Attend press visits and represent the magazine at industry events as required for a fact-finding purpose for writing articles, to see contacts and source new ones and to take relevant photos, to raise the profile of the journal and increase industry knowledge
Interview industry figureheads
Opportunity to launch regular podcast
To break news stories
Produce copy for our website, and update website with news, diary events and show information
To maintain our social media (Twitter and LinkedIn) profiles
Respond to general external enquiries and problems
Suggest topics for publication and contribute ideas
Lay out pages (editorial copy and photography) using Adobe packages
